Thursday, July 03, 2008 – 7:35 P.M.
This was an EXCELLENT day for me!
When I got up this morning, I had very little pain in my back, but it began increasing as the day wore on. By early this afternoon, it got to the point where I had to take pain medicine for it.
I had a two o’clock physical therapy appointment. My driver managed to pick me up on time for a change. He took the slowest route in town, where he managed to hit almost every red light in existence, but at least I made it to my appointment on time.
By the time my physical therapist (Chris), and two others, got me out of my wheelchair and onto two traction tables, my pain had risen to a level of seven. Chris was not happy about that, and quickly began working on me.
She placed one bolster between my legs, and another one under them. Then she kept working on my position until my body was in a straight alignment from head to toe. By then, my pain level had decreased to two.
Chris then began rolling me from side-to-side as she stretched muscles in my legs and back. She also worked on my neck and shoulders. In practically no time at all, I was completely pain-free. I had not felt that good in several months.
She said she still believes that I will really benefit from having therapy in a pool. I will be seeing my doctor next Friday, and will ask for a prescription calling for that type of therapy. Assuming that my doctor agrees to that, Chris will then need to get permission from her boss before I get to use their pool, and she will need to “recruit” one other person to help her with me. The whole plan also needs to be approved by Medicare.
I am trying to be positive, and cautiously optimistic, about all these plans working out. I would like to have more good days like this one.
